I have a question about SAAF Buccaneer schemes - I once saw a photo of an aircraft in late scheme, no castles, and had a tiny national flag (orange/white/blue) on the fin. I'd like to finish this model in that scheme but can't find that photo to confirm it - can anyone help me out?
Thanks!

I have no digital copies of the scheme, but it seems a late 70's thing. There is a tiny Oranje-blanje-Blou on the tail and a small castle in front of the intakes. Dare I say the castle is about the size as what would have been on the Mirages? No other castles were on the wings. The scheme is the late scheme as you described.

I have a photo of 423(1977) and one of 416 (1979) in this scheme.
